Spammers seem to be really lazy. The only time I’ve received spam on my own domain was when I changed servers and forgot to enable the Postgrey service. Grey-listing has been around for long enough (a couple of decades) so I would have expected spammers to be resending emails that are rejected with a temporary error.

So I wasn’t expecting Postgrey to provide much benefit. As it happens, in 10 years of running my own mail server, it’s the only anti-spam measure I’ve had to bother with.
